Specialized Orthopaedic Services Salary

As of July 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Specialized Orthopaedic Services in the United States is $103,908.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$50. Salaries at Specialized Orthopaedic Services typically range from $91,544 to $117,342 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About Specialized Orthopaedic Services
We service patients of all ages, some of them professional athletes, active duty military, pediatric and geriatric. We are Accredited through the American Board for Certification. Our comprehensive list of national and local insurance contracts allows patients to receive in-network coverage . What Is the Cost of Living Near Alexandria?

Understanding the cost of living near Alexandria is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Specialized Orthopaedic Services.
Alexandria's Cost of Living Index is approximately 149.8 (49.8% more expensive than US average; 43.9% more than VA average). Historic city near DC, very high housing costs. DASH bus, Metro Yellow/Blue Lines. When planning your budget based on a salary from Specialized Orthopaedic Services,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,100 - $3,200+ A significant portion of Specialized Orthopaedic Services sal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$130 - $220 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$40 (DASH pass, Metro extra)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$470 - $700 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$500 - $900+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$410 - $760+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,650 - $5,780+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
